  • Statement of problem. Implant abutment screw joints tend to loosen under clinical conditions. Abutment screw loosening results in loss of preload in function. Purpose. Anti-rotational inner post screw (ARIPS) systems were compared with conventional abutment screws to reduce screw loosening. Reverse torque values were evaluated. Material and methods. 32 implant assemblies (Warentec, Co, Ltd, Seoul, Korea) were organized as the 30-Ncm-torque conventional groups and 30-Ncm-torque ARIPS groups in external and internal system. The specimens were tested to 106 cycles at a load of 200N. Preload reverse torque, postload reverse torque, and the ratio of postload reverse torque to preload reverse torque were evaluated. The data were analyzed with unpaired t-test in external and internal systems. Results. In the ratio of postload reverse torque to preload reverse torque, the ARIPS groups showed significant differences than the conventional screw group in both external and internal system. Conclusion. Within the limitations of this study, abutment screw loosening was effectively reduced using ARIPS system.

  • The hearing mechanism is a complicated system. Sound is generated by a source that sends out air pressure or power. The pressure or power makes the sound waves. These waves reach the eardrum, or tympanic membrane, which vibrates at a rate and magnitude proportional to the nature of the sound waves. The tympanic membrane transforms this vibration into the mechanical energy in the middle ear, which in turn converts it to the hydraulic energy in the fluid of the inner ear. The hydraulic energy stimulates the sensory cells of the inner ear which send neuroelectrical impulses to the central auditory nervous system. The passive perception of auditory information starts just here. The listener gives attention to the speech sound, differentiates the sound from background noise, and integrates his experience with similar sounds. The listener then puts all of these aspects of audition into the context of the moment to identify the nature of sound. This has a major role in human communication. This paper provides an overview of the nature and characteristics of sound, the structure and function of the auditory system, and the way in which sound is processed by the auditory system.

  • Computer is a very powerful machine which is widely using for data processing, DB construction, peripheral device control, image processing etc. Consequently, many researches and developments have progressed for high performance processing unit, and other devices. Especially, the core units such as semiconductor parts are rapidly growing so that high-integration, high-performance, microminiat turization is possible. The packaging in the semiconductor industry is very important technique to de determine the performance of the system that the semiconductor is used. In this paper, the inspection of the inner defects such as delamination, void, crack, etc. in the semiconductor packages is studied. ESPI which is a non-contact, non-destructive, and full-field inspection method is used for the inner defect inspection and its results are compared with that of C-Scan method.

  • We fabricated surface pattern on a light guide panel (LGP) using $CO_2$ laser to improve the luminescence performance of inner-scatterer LGP, which is made of PMMA sample with exploiting Q-switched $2^{nd}$ harmonic Nd:YAG laser engraving system, and the effect of surface pattern in the brightness distribution of LGP was analysed. To prove the feasibility of proposed method in the enhancement of LGP performance, we designed three different surface patterns on the inner-scatterer LGP. The experimental results has proved the potential in the application of surface pattern to increasing the brightness of inner-scatterer LGP.

  • Middle size of membrane retractable roof is under 25m span which consists of various moving systems. Sliding carriage is the system that leads the membrane to parking place, transferring the load from the membrane to structural cable. When membrane moves roof, thus, structural behavior of sliding carriage, which may contain various shapes with friction coefficients, should be investigated by vertical load as well as horizontal load. Nummerical simulation of sliding carriage prototypes, in this research, were performed by incrementation of vertical load and horizontal load as well. Consequently, this paper evaluated proper shapes of inner holder of Sliding carriage and evaluated the effective contact area of inner hold.

  • In this work, the imaginary part of the inner modulation transfer function of the cutting dynamics is introduced for tool wear monitoring. Time-series method is utilized to construct the general three dimensional cutting dynamics whose imaginary part of the inner modulation transfer funcition shows the proportionality to tool wear at the natural frequency of the machine tool dynamics. Thus model is reduced to single-input single-output model without altering the proportionality characteristics to tool wear and implemented to the dual computer system in which one computer performs measurement while the other calculates the imaginary part of the inner modulation transfer function of the cutting dynamics by the batch least square method. The values of the imaginary part at the natural requency of the machine tool structure in the cutting direction are compared to the one calculated during machining with a brand new tool to decide the current status of the tool. The experiments shows the relevance of the proposed concept.

  • Contrast enhanced magnetic resonance imaging using gadolinium-based contrast agent (GBCA) is a very useful in vivo technique to visualize the inner ear pathology including endolymphatic hydrops. Although systemic intravenous (IV) administration can visualize the perilymph space, the visualization was possible by indirect passage of contrast agent through blood-perilymph barrier. All animal experimental procedures were performed under anesthesia with 5% isoflurane. Lipopolysaccharide (LPS) was instilled into the left tympanic cavity through the tympanic membrane using a sterile 27gauge needle to induce hydrops model. Tucker-Davis Technologies system was used to measure Auditory Brainstem Responses (ABRs). For intracerebroven-tricular (ICV) administration, 25 µmol of GADOVIST (Bayer, Berlin, Germany) was used and diluted GADOVIST injection was 10 µl. MR imaging was acquired with a 9.4 Tesla MRI scanner. Transmit-receive volume coil with 40 mm inner diameter and 75 mm out diameter was used. ICV administration well demonstrated the strong enhancement along the c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) microcirculation pathway including CSF fluid in the subarachnoid space and CSF space of the inner ear structures. On the other hand, IV administration showed no contrast enhancement along the CSF microcirculation pathway and showed weak enhancement in the inner ear structures. In case of rat hydrops model, ICV administration showed that the reduced contrast enhancement in the perilymph space of the hydrops induced inner ear compared to the contrast enhancement in the perilymph space of the normal inner ear. New systemic ICV administration method provide contrast enhancement of GBCA in the inner ear through CSF microcirculation pathway.

  • A concatenated coding system using a binary code as the inner code and a nonbinary code as the outer code has been constructed for the purpose of error correction. The complexity of a conventional coding system grows exponentially as the code length of a block code becomes longer. To reduce the complexity for ling code, an effective communication system has been proposed by cascading two codes-binary and norbinary codes. Using a parallel-to-serial circuit and a serial-to-parallel circuit, the concatenated coding system has been designed and constructed by empolying a (7,3) burst error correcting code as the inner code and a (7,3) Reed-Solomon code as the outer code. This system has been simulated and tested using a micro-computer. For the (49,9) concatenated coding system, the error probability of the channel has been evaluated and compared to different coding systems.

  • In this paper, the dynamic compliance and its compensation control of the force control system on the highly integrated valve-controlled cylinder (HIVC), the joint driver of the hydraulic drive legged robot, is researched. During the robot motion process, the outer loop dynamic compliance control is applied on the base of hydraulic control inner loop and most inner loop control are the force or torque closed loop control. While the dynamic compliance control effectiveness of outer loop can be affected by the inner loop self-dynamic-compliance. Based on this problem, the dynamic compliance series composition theory of HIVC force control system as well as the analysis of its self-dynamic-compliance is proposed. And then the paper comes up with the compliance-enhanced control, which is a compound compensation control method of dynamic compliance with multiple series branches. Finally, the experiment results indicate that the control method mentioned above can enhance the dynamic compliance of HIVC force control system observably. This provides the compensation control method of inner loop dynamic compliance for the outer loop compliance control requiring the high accuracy and high robustness for the robot.
